What is the length of the altitude of the equilateral triangle?

The altitude of an equilateral triangle is (√3)/2*a. where 'a' is the side of the triangle. It can be just find by giving a perpendicular to the base of the triangle, the base of the triangle become a/2 and one side is a. so by applying Pythagoras theorem we will get the desired formula.

What is the length of the altitude of an equilateral triangle with sides of length 6?

The altitude forms a right angle triangle with half the side length and one side as the hypotenuse. Using Pythagoras: (½side)² + altitude² = side² → altitude² = side² - ¼side² → altitude² = ¾side² → altitude = (√3)/2 × side → altitude = (√3)/2 × 6 = 3√3 ≈ 5.2
